Udupi to Monitor Liquor Activities During Lok Sabha Elections

Udupi: In preparation for the upcoming Lok Sabha elections, the Excise Department in Udupi has set up control rooms at taluk headquarters in Udupi district to oversee the production, sale of counterfeit liquor, and prevent the distribution of liquor to influence voters.

The Excise Deputy Commissioner is encouraging the public to report any instances of illegal sale and distribution of liquor in Udupi. Information can be communicated to the department through control rooms in Udupi or directly to officers. The toll-free number for reporting is 1800 4250 732. Additionally, the public can contact specific control rooms at Udupi taluk (0820-2532732), Kundapura taluk (08254-200902), and Karkala taluk (08258-298865).

Individuals in Udupi can also reach out to officers directly using the following numbers: District Deputy Commissioner of Excise (9449597104), Udupi Deputy Superintendent of Excise (9538721125), Kundapura Deputy Superintendent of Excise (9900681914), Udupi Excise Inspector (9845412095), Kundapura Excise Inspector (7676269418), and Karkala Excise Inspector (9902729126). The initiative aims to curb the illegal activities related to liquor during the election period.
